The following study project illustrates the gastro-protective impact of Terminalia coriacea on aspirin-induced rat model ulcers. In both pylorus binding rats and gastric ulcerogenesis, the gastroprotective effects were contextual. The protective operation was correlated with the decrease in the gastric ulcer reports, gastric emissions and sharpness and exacerbation by NF-ŢB inhibition, neutrophil identification and ROS decline due to its antioxidant properties. Aspirin treatment, caused completely the frequency of gastric ulcerations. The combination of decided measures has no extra pain relief impact on its stratified components because the combination of TCFE medicinally induced with aspirin has an extra pain relief impact on aspirin alone and is not proved to be ulcerative.
